The Shift Towards Decentralized Intelligence in 2026
The architecture of digital applications has actually undergone an extreme shift as 2026 unfolds. For several years, the market leaned on central data centers to deal with every calculation, but the physical constraints of light speed and optical fiber eventually hit a wall. In the present environment, the focus has moved from enormous, far-off server farms to smaller sized, localized nodes that process details exactly where it is generated. This transition is driven by the increase of autonomous equipment, sophisticated wearable medical devices, and augmented truth systems that need action times under 5 milliseconds.Moving information backward and forward to a central center develops a bottleneck that 2026 innovation can no longer endure. Modern designers are instead building dispersed systems that deal with the edge not simply as a cache, but as a main compute layer. By positioning high-density silicon near the user, companies can filter, evaluate, and act on data without waiting for a round-trip to a local data. This method significantly reduces the pressure on backhaul networks and guarantees that vital safety systems in self-driving automobiles or robotic surgery systems function despite wider internet failures.

Hardware Developments Powering the 2026 Edge
The servers found at the edge today look absolutely nothing like the rack-mounted units of the previous decade. In 2026, we see a rise in fanless, hardened systems geared up with specialized Neural Processing Units (NPUs) These chips are developed specifically for reasoning, permitting gadgets to run complex machine discovering models with very little power usage. This hardware enables sophisticated image recognition and voice processing directly on the gadget, which is vital for privacy and speed.Reliability in these areas is a significant issue. Edge nodes often sit in severe environments-- connected to cell towers, inside factory floors, or tucked into utility boxes. These systems should endure temperature swings and vibration while maintaining a continuous connection. To fix this, 2026 architectures typically incorporate redundant mesh networking, where nodes can talk to each other to discover a course back to the internet if one link fails. Data Consistency and Synchronization Obstacles
Maintaining a single variation of the reality across a thousand different edge areas is a significant technical difficulty. Conventional databases often battle with the latency included in international locking systems. Instead, designers in 2026 use Conflict-free Replicated Data Types (CRDTs) and eventual consistency models. These allow each edge node to continue running independently during a network split, merging their modifications as soon as the connection is restored.This decentralized information model is particularly helpful for retail and logistics. A shipment drone or a clever warehouse robotic can update its inventory log in your area and sync with the more comprehensive system when it passes a high-speed transit point. This makes sure that the machine is never awaiting a "success" signal from a server 3 states away before it can relocate to its next task. Security Protocols for a Perimeter-less Environment
The growth of the compute boundary produces a much bigger surface area for prospective attacks. In 2026, the old "castle and moat" security philosophy is dead. Every edge node is dealt with as a prospective point of compromise, causing the widespread adoption of zero-trust architectures. Each micro-service must prove its identity before it can interact with another, and information is secured both at rest and in transit utilizing hardware-level keys.Confidential computing has also end up being a basic requirement. By using Trusted Execution Environments (TEEs), 2026 applications can process delicate user data in a safe and secure enclave that even the owner of the physical hardware can not access. The Function of 6G and Advanced Connectivity

While 5G laid the groundwork, the initial rollout of 6G testing in 2026 is providing the high-frequency bands required for huge device density. These connections provide the bandwidth required for holographic interaction and real-time digital twins. In commercial settings, this means a factory supervisor can view a real-time 3D overlay of the assembly line, with every sensing unit reading reflected in the model with absolutely no perceptible lag.The integration of satellite-based web has actually likewise altered the logic of the edge. Remote mining websites or maritime vessels can now act as edge nodes that sync via low-earth orbit constellations. This permits high-performance computing in locations that were formerly digital dead zones. The architecture should be wise sufficient to switch in between cellular, satellite, and local Wi-Fi based upon cost and signal strength, a process understood as multi-access edge computing.
